Introduction


As a house owner, identifying indications that suggest your home requirements immediate plumbing attention is critical for preventing pricey damages and trouble. Let's explore some of the leading indicators you should never overlook.

Lowered Water Stress


One of one of the most usual signs of plumbing issues is decreased water pressure. If you notice a substantial decrease in water pressure in your faucets or showerheads, it can indicate underlying problems such as pipeline leakages, mineral build-up, or problems with the supply of water line.

Slow Drain


Slow-moving drainage is one more red flag that should not be ignored. If water takes longer than usual to drain from sinks, showers, or bath tubs, it could suggest an obstruction in the pipes. Neglecting this problem can result in finish clogs and potential water damage.

Abrupt Rise in Water Bills


If you observe an unexpected spike in your water costs without an equivalent increase in usage, it's a solid sign of hidden leaks. Even small leaks can lose substantial amounts of water in time, leading to inflated water bills.

Strange Noises


Gurgling, banging, or whistling sounds coming from your plumbing system are not typical and should be examined promptly. These noises could be caused by concerns such as air in the pipes, loose installations, or water hammer-- a sensation where water circulation is abruptly quit.

Foundation Cracks


Fractures in your home's foundation might signify underlying plumbing concerns, specifically if they accompany water-related problems indoors. Water leaks from pipes or drain lines can cause soil erosion, leading to foundation settlement and cracks.

Undesirable Odors


Foul odors emanating from drains or sewage system lines are not just unpleasant however likewise indicative of plumbing problems. Sewage system smells may recommend a harmed drain line or a dried-out P-trap, while musty scents could signify mold and mildew growth from water leakages.

Noticeable Water Damage


Water discolorations on wall surfaces or ceilings, along with mold and mildew or mildew development, are clear indications of water leaks that call for instant attention. Overlooking these indications can bring about architectural damage, endangered interior air quality, and pricey repair work.

HOW TO KNOW IF YOUR HOUSE NEEDS PLUMBING MAINTENANCE?


Your home’s plumbing system plays a vital role in ensuring the smooth flow of water and maintaining a comfortable living environment. However, over time, wear and tear can occur, leading to plumbing issues that can disrupt your daily routine. To avoid costly repairs and unexpected emergencies, regular plumbing maintenance is essential. If you are asking how to know if your house needs a plumbing maintenance, here are some key signs to watch for and maintenance tips to keep your home’s water systems in excellent condition.


Watch for Warning Signs.


Several indicators can suggest that your home needs plumbing maintenance. These signs include slow drainage, low water pressure, recurring leaks, foul odors, and unusual sounds coming from the pipes. Pay attention to these warnings as they can indicate underlying issues that require immediate attention.


Schedule Regular Inspections.


Preventive maintenance is crucial to catch plumbing problems before they escalate. Consider scheduling regular inspections with a professional plumber who can assess your plumbing system for any hidden leaks, corrosion, or potential issues. Regular inspections can help you identify problems early on, saving you from costly repairs and water damage.


Maintain Drainage Systems.


Clogged drains are a common plumbing issue that can lead to water backups and other complications. Avoid pouring grease, coffee grounds, or other debris down the drain, and use drain covers to prevent hair and debris from entering the pipes. Regularly clean your drains using natural remedies or approved drain cleaners to keep them clear. Winterize Your Plumbing.


In colder climates, freezing temperatures can cause pipes to burst, leading to significant water damage. Before the winter season arrives, insulate exposed pipes, disconnect outdoor hoses, and consider installing pipe insulation sleeves. Taking these preventive measures can protect your plumbing system during freezing weather.


Regular plumbing maintenance is essential for a well-functioning home. By paying attention to warning signs, scheduling inspections, maintaining drainage systems, and winterizing your plumbing, you can prevent costly repairs and ensure a smoothly running water system. Remember, proactive maintenance is the key to a hassle-free and functional home.
